Transaction 2d31c8d51a1d2b63885c5127c0aa50ec2227eb6c87e91d9640ecf57a3427e6f6
1 Input
2 Outputs
- 2d31c8d51a1d2b63885c5127c0aa50ec2227eb6c87e91d9640ecf57a3427e6f6:0
- 2d31c8d51a1d2b63885c5127c0aa50ec2227eb6c87e91d9640ecf57a3427e6f6:1
value 621658
address 1FyAB7mHjEKfB3w1a4XR3irmu79FmTgUY
value 839433
address 17HJZKsVzeDDuVnQJZ5SzSQP3mtgCcHNNL